In my opinion the Big Chief is a hassle and waste of space when a A-MAZE-N smoking product will accomplish a consistent, quality smoke with very little space used inside the freezer.
My converted freezer/smoker that I had used wood chips in now has been using the 5"X8" pellet smoker in for the last 2 years and am happy with the smoke. This year come sausage time I am going to try the tube smoker also.
I just ran across it & thought it was pretty interesting. The plastic interior was my question concerning safety. I don't know if I have ever seen one with the plastic still in place I thought that was a No-No
Well the temps generated by the big chief aren't going to be very high to begin with, plus the hose and the large space in the freezer, I doubt its going to get much over 100 degrees in there. Pretty much only a cold smoker. Should be fine.
